Established Product Manufacturers

Finding a company that can manufacture soap (known as โรงงานผลิตสบู่สร้างแบรนด์ in Thai) and other skin-care products and use your own unique packaging is quite easy with a Google search, and once you have located an OEM supplier, you are already halfway there. The supplier would have an extensive range of skin care products to choose from, with items such as:

  • Shampoos
  • Conditioners
  • Soaps
  • Skin Creams
  • Facial Applications
  • Skin Whitening Products
  • Acne Creams

The supplier would only offer products that are tried and tested and are fully approved for retail marketing, which allows you to by-pass the lengthy (and costly) process to getting FDA approval. Book a tour of the facility, when you can see first-hand how the products are made, and prepare a list of questions to ask the management, which will help you to make an informed decision.

Designing your Branding

You will need the help of a professional company to ensure that your branding & packaging are top drawer and by shipping your packaging to the OEM supplier, they will do the rest and deliver the finished product to your warehouse, ready for sale. If you are unsure how to go about sourcing a packaging manufacturer, talk to the production company, as they would certainly have contacts within the industry.

E-Commerce Platform

Rather than going into the huge expense of leasing a retail premises, you are much better off selling your skin care products online, and by hooking up with a leading web designer, you can create the perfect digital platform to market your products. Building a shopping cart website is no easy thing, so you will need to seek out some professional help with your web design, and once that is done, you will need to look at digital marketing.

Free Product Samples

You should set aside a small budget to produce a range of handout samples of your entire product range, which should result in quite a few regular customers who are impressed with the products. Handing these out at shopping malls is the best way to get your name and your products out there, which is just one way to make shoppers aware that you are in business.
